Lighter and cheaper: 1972 TVR Vixen

This is a 1972 TVR Vixen 2500, one of those light, direct British sports cars that isn’t about perfect numbers so much as pure feel. Affordable red granny: 1963 Alfa Romeo Giulia Spider

This Giulia Spider seems one of the last of its breed to have still an affordable price, while being in good conditions. It is said to be sitting in an enclosed garage since 2001.
